On 21.03.2013, at 16:25, Morgen Sagen wrote:

> Those are annoying but harmless, and I believe have already been taken care 
> of in more recent versions of OS X Server.  I don't remember exactly when it 
> was fixed, but I'm running Server 2.2.1 on top of OS X 10.8.2 and I don't see 
> those messages.
